Okay, with that out of the way, I have to say...oh my FREAKIN' God! This episode absolutely proves my theory that finding out who the bad guy is, or whatever rumor you hear about who or what is in it, totally does not diminish a show. The "spoilers" we get aren't real spoilers at all because they don't spoil the actual important part of the episode. It's the how and why that never seems to get leaked because it doesn't seem important which ends up being the most important of all.

On the subject of spoilers...

Spoilers...I love 'em.

Now, I know many people absolutely hate them with a passion. I have friends that won't even let me say if something they haven't seen is good or not. "Oh, Midnight was gr--" "DON'T TELL ME!" Well, good grief. I was just going to say it was great. Sue me. That is one of the reasons why I started this blog, even though I haven't gotten to it yet. I'd like to actually be able to talk about episodes people might not have seen yet without being yelled at for even saying if an episode is good or not.
